Development of an All-in-One Land Investment Management Platform

buildableworks.com
Real estate
Business services

Identifying Challenges in Land Investment Operations and Data Management

The client faces outdated technologies and fragmented data sources that hinder efficient land investment activities. Manual data processing, disjointed digital tools, and limited automation create inefficiencies, delaying property acquisition decisions and reducing competitive advantage in the market.

About the Client

A mid-size real estate investment firm seeking to streamline land acquisition and investment processes with integrated data management and client servicing tools.

Goals for Building an Integrated Land Investment Platform

  • Create a centralized digital platform to streamline land property data collection, scrubbing, and analysis.
  • Enhance property discovery through integration with external property databases.
  • Implement stepwise wizard workflows for user engagement in property listing and purchase request processes.
  • Support tiered subscription models with role-based access for different user types.
  • Ensure secure payment processing and seamless integration with payment gateways.
  • Deploy a scalable, secure, and user-friendly platform that accelerates property distribution and improves operational efficiency.

Core Functionalities and Features of the Land Investment Platform

  • Interactive wizard-based interfaces guiding users through data import, property analysis, and listing creation.
  • Integration with external property data APIs (similar to property databases like DataTree) for importing and exporting property listings.
  • Custom data scrubbing algorithms to filter and clean large datasets based on user-defined criteria.
  • Subscription management with tiered access privileges, utilizing secure payment processing solutions.
  • Role-based user management supporting multiple user types (investors, analysts, admins).
  • Secure transaction handling and data security measures.
  • Dashboard views providing real-time insights into property portfolios and investment metrics.
  • Export functions allowing data or property lists to Excel, CSV, or other formats.

Technological Stack and Architecture Preferences

.NET Core for backend development
Angular, TypeScript with modern JavaScript frameworks
Bootstrap for responsive UI design
Entity Framework and LINQ for data access
SQL Server or equivalent relational database
Linux environment for deployment
JSON for data interchange

External System Integrations for Data and Payment Processing

  • Property data APIs for property discovery and export
  • Secure payment gateways (similar to Stripe) for subscription billing
  • Data scrubbing algorithms or services for data cleaning
  • Authentication and role management systems

Performance, Security, and Scalability Requirements

  • Platform should support concurrent usage for at least 100 users with minimal latency.
  • Data security adhering to best practices, with encrypted transactions and secure authentication.
  • Scalable architecture to handle growing property data and user base.
  • High system availability with 99.9% uptime.
  • Responsive interfaces for desktop and mobile devices.

Projected Business Benefits and Success Metrics

The new platform is expected to significantly accelerate property distribution, enabling faster decision-making and reducing processing times by up to 50%. It aims to support multiple subscription tiers, improve data handling efficiency, and provide real-time property insights, thus enhancing market competitiveness and operational productivity.
